#6f7f72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f7f72 is composed of 43.5% red, 49.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.2%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 131.3 degrees, a saturation of 6.7% and a lightness of 46.7%. #6f7f72 color hex could be obtained by blending #defee4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#6f7f72 color description : Dark grayish lime green.
#6f7f72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f7f72 has RGB values of R:111, G:127,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 7307122.
